Fighting the Virus: Disease Modeling and Cyber Security

Om Fighting the Virus: Disease Modeling and Cyber Security

Many of the words used to describe disease ('infection', 'transmission', 'virus') are also used to characterize cyber security (for example: a computer is infected by a virus that can be transmitted to other current uninfected computers). This correspondence is much more than a convenient metaphor, and the aim of this book is to show how the models developed to understand the dynamics of infection, recovery, and possible infection in disease can be applied to understand attack, compromise, and recovery of components of a cyber system and how such attacks affect performance of the cyber system or its dependent enabled physical system.
